Job Description

Job Title:
Front Desk Coordinator / Medical Receptionist Position Overview We are seeking an organized, quick-thinking, and reliable Front Desk Coordinator to manage checking-in, insurance coordination, and patient scheduling for a fast-paced community medical practice. This position serves as the vital first point of contact for our patients and requires someone who can rapidly master complex workflows. This position is a temporary role to cover a leave of absence, with the potential to convert into a permanent contract-to-hire opportunity. Job Responsibilities Execute a heavy volume of insurance verifications, benefit verifications, and pre-authorizations by directly contacting insurance payers. Manage patient scheduling through the practice Electronic Medical Records (EMR) system. Actively reach out to inbound clinical patient leads via text messages and outbound phone calls to book new appointments. Coordinate front office operations within a tight-knit, collaborative 5-person clinical team. Schedule & Shift Breakdown Enjoy an excellent work-life balance with no nights and no weekends : Monday through
Thursday:
8:00 AM - 5:00 PM (usually wrapped up by 4:30 PM).
Friday:
8:00 AM - 1:00 PM (short, fast-paced half-day). Includes a designated 1-hour lunch break Monday through Thursday from 12:00 PM - 1:00 PM. Required Skills & Qualifications High school graduate or equivalent education. Strong computer literacy with the ability to retain and master complex medical workflows and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) quickly. Exceptional personal accountability and the maturity to handle constructive feedback constructively. High adaptability and communication skills required to manage a diverse mesh of patient and staff personalities. Ability to work on-site at the clinic and keep pace during busy, high-volume days. Preferred Skills Bilingual (Spanish): Strongly preferred, as roughly 60% of the active patient demographic speaks Spanish.
Compensation & Perks Competitive Pay:
$20.00 - $22.00 per hour (depending on experience).
Uniform Benefit:
Work environment requires solid black scrubs. A $100 uniform certificate is provided to purchase apparel.
Culture:
Join a collegial, friendly, and genuinely fun office environment under direct physician leadership.
